When you're working on projects with particle board, picking the right self-tapping screws really matters if you want things to stay stable and last a good long while. A big thing to keep in mind is the screw length — usually, going for at least 1 inch is the way to go. It gives you a solid grip without poking through the other side or being too short to hold everything tight.
Also, pay attention to what the screws are made of. Going with coated or stainless steel screws is a smart move, especially if your project might be exposed to humidity or moisture. It’s a small step that can seriously boost how long your work holds up.
Here’s a quick tip: try a test run first. Just screw in a couple of these to see if they fit snugly and hold well before doing the full job. And don’t forget about the thread types! Finer threads are better for thinner materials, while coarser threads do a much better job with thicker boards, giving you that solid grip and support you want.
When you're picking out the right self-tapping screws for particle board projects, it’s pretty important to know the recommended sizes and lengths. A report from the Woodwork Institute suggests that most folks tend to use screws ranging from #6 to #10, with lengths anywhere from 1 inch up to about 2.5 inches, depending on how thick the material is. For the typical particle board, a #8 Screw that's about 1.25 inches long usually hits the sweet spot—giving enough grip without risking splitting the board or making it shear.
Oh, and don’t forget to pay attention to the screw’s thread type. Based on standards from the American National Standards Institute (ANSI), coarse-thread screws tend to work better in particle board because they grip better and are less likely to cause splitting. Plus, using a screw that's at least a quarter inch longer than the thickness of your board can really help keep things sturdy and make sure your project holds up over time. Just taking a little time to think about size and length makes a huge difference when you're putting together furniture or fixtures with particle board — leads to a reliable, solid finish.

Hey! When you're working with particle boards, it's super important to pick the right self-tapping screws to make sure everything stays secure and lasts a good long time. A handy tip is to pre-drill a pilot hole that's just a bit smaller than the screw itself. This really helps guide the screw in smoothly and cuts down on the chances of splitting the board — especially if you're dealing with thicker screws.
Another thing to keep in mind is to go for screws that have a sharp point and coarse threads, specifically made for particle board. Trust me, those features make screwing in way easier and give you a stronger grip, particularly in softer materials. Oh, and do make sure your screws are corrosion-resistant if your project might get wet — nobody wants rusty screws ruining everything.
And here’s a final tip: when you're installing those self-tapping screws, try to keep your pressure steady and don’t overdo it on the tightness. Tightening too much can strip the hole or mess up the surface of the board. Using a drill with torque control can really help you keep things in check, making sure the screws are snug but not over-tightened. If you follow these simple tips, you'll end up with a pretty solid, reliable setup for your particle board projects — no stress, just good results!
